What is Esperion Therapeutics's debt-to-assets?
Esperion Therapeutics (ESPR) reported debt-to-assets of 0.3× in Q1 2026.
How has Esperion Therapeutics's debt-to-assets changed year-over-year?
Esperion Therapeutics's debt-to-assets decreased by 25.6% year-over-year, from 0.5× to 0.3×.
What is the long-term trend for Esperion Therapeutics's debt-to-assets?
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), Esperion Therapeutics's debt-to-assets has grown at a 81.0%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from 0× to 0.3×.
What does debt-to-assets mean?
Total debt divided by total assets at the quarter end. Measures the share of the asset base financed by debt.
